大学专用智能评教系统源代码ASP.NET
"大学专用智能评教系统源代码ASP.NET"是一个专门为高等教育机构设计的在线教学质量评估平台的源代码实现。该系统基于ASP.NET技术,它提供了便捷、高效且智能化的评教功能,旨在帮助大学改进教学质量,提升教育管理水平。 这个智能评教系统源代码实现了多种功能,包括但不限于学生评教、教师自我评估、课程评价、数据统计与分析等。ASP.NET是微软公司推出的Web应用开发框架,以其稳定性和强大的功能受到开发者的青睐。通过使用ASP.NET,开发者可以构建出高性能、安全性和扩展性良好的网络应用程序。 "评教系统"指的是高校中用于收集学生对教师和课程评价的信息化工具。这样的系统通常包含学生评教模块、教师反馈模块、管理模块以及数据分析模块。评教结果对于改进教学方法、提高教学质量具有重要意义,同时也有助于教学管理部门了解学生需求,进行有针对性的教学改革。 【详细知识点】 1. **ASP.NET框架**:ASP.NET是.NET Framework的一部分,提供了丰富的服务器控件、内置状态管理机制和事件驱动模型,简化了Web应用的开发过程。它支持多种编程语言,如C#、VB.NET等,并且提供了ASP.NET MVC、Web Forms、Web API等多种开发模式。 2. **数据库设计**:智能评教系统可能使用SQL Server、MySQL或其他关系型数据库存储评教数据。数据库设计包括用户表(学生、教师信息)、课程表、评教表等,确保数据的结构化和规范化。 3. **用户界面**:使用ASP.NET的Web Forms或ASP.NET MVC,开发者可以创建交互性强、用户体验好的评教页面。学生可以方便地对课程和教师进行评分和评论,教师可以查看自己的评价报告。 4. **安全性**:ASP.NET提供身份验证和授权机制,可以确保只有授权的用户才能访问特定的功能。这对于保护评教数据的隐私至关重要。 5. **评教功能**:系统应包含多种评教维度,如教学态度、教学方法、课程难度等,允许学生根据不同的指标进行打分。同时,可能还支持开放性问题,让学生提供详细反馈。 6. **数据统计与分析**:系统需要有强大的数据分析功能,能够汇总评教结果,生成图表,为管理层提供决策依据。例如,可以计算平均分、标准差等统计量,找出优秀教师和待改进的课程。 7. **权限管理**:管理员可以设置不同角色(如学生、教师、教务人员)的权限,控制他们对系统的操作范围。 8. **接口集成**:系统可能需要与其他校园信息系统(如教务管理系统)进行数据交换,实现数据同步,提升整体效率。 9. **响应式设计**:考虑到移动设备的广泛使用,系统应具备响应式布局,确保在各种屏幕尺寸上都能正常运行。 10. **持续集成与部署**:利用Visual Studio的持续集成工具,开发者可以自动化构建、测试和部署,确保代码质量和系统稳定性。 "大学专用智能评教系统源代码ASP.NET"是一项结合了软件工程、数据库设计、Web开发和教育管理的复杂项目,其目标是为高校提供一个实用、高效且安全的在线评教解决方案。通过深入理解和运用这些知识点,开发者可以构建出满足教育行业需求的高质量评教系统。
- 粉丝: 0
- 资源: 3
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
- 1
- 2
- 3
- 4
- 5
前往页